All type 247 airheads from 79 onwards had bean cans. Points type in 79 - 80 and hall sensor 81 on. As far as I can make out this includes the post 85 models up to the end of airhead production in 95.

R45/R65's (type 248) as above except we had points type bean cans a year earlier in 78.
